(String, Object, TimeSpan, IEnumerable genérico) de método de DataCache.Put
Agrega o reemplaza un objeto en la memoria caché. Especifica el valor de tiempo de espera y asocia etiquetas al objeto en caché.
Espacio de nombres: Microsoft.ApplicationServer.Caching
Ensamblado: Microsoft.ApplicationServer.Caching.Client (en microsoft.applicationserver.caching.client.dll)
Uso
Sintaxis
'Declaración
Public Function Put ( _
key As String, _
value As Object, _
timeout As TimeSpan, _
tags As IEnumerable(Of DataCacheTag) _
) As DataCacheItemVersion
public DataCacheItemVersion Put (
string key,
Object value,
TimeSpan timeout,
IEnumerable<DataCacheTag> tags
)
public:
DataCacheItemVersion^ Put (
String^ key,
Object^ value,
TimeSpan timeout,
IEnumerable<DataCacheTag^>^ tags
)
public DataCacheItemVersion Put (
String key,
Object value,
TimeSpan timeout,
IEnumerable<DataCacheTag> tags
)
public function Put (
key : String,
value : Object,
timeout : TimeSpan,
tags : IEnumerable<DataCacheTag>
) : DataCacheItemVersion
Parámetros
- key
Valor exclusivo que se usa para identificar el objeto en caché.
- value
Objeto que se va a agregar o reemplazar.
- timeout
Tiempo que el objeto debe residir en la memoria caché antes de su expiración.
- tags
Lista de etiquetas que se asociarán al objeto.
Valor devuelto
Objeto DataCacheItemVersion que representa la versión del objeto guardado en caché bajo el valor key.
Comentarios
Las etiquetas se pueden usar solamente para recuperar un objeto en caché si dicho objeto se encuentra almacenado en una región. Esta sobrecarga no almacena el objeto en una región.
El valor timeout asociado al objeto en caché reemplaza las opciones de expiración especificadas en la configuración de la memoria caché con nombre. Para obtener más información, vea Caducidad y expulsión.
Para obtener más información sobre el uso de este método, vea Procedimiento: Actualizar un objeto de la memoria caché.
Seguridad para subprocesos
Todos los miembros públicos y estáticos (Shared en Visual Basic) de este tipo son seguros para subprocesos. No se garantiza que los miembros de instancia sean seguros para subprocesos.
Plataformas
Plataformas de desarrollo
Visual Studio 2010 y posterior, .NET Framework 4
Plataformas de destino
Windows 7; Windows Server 2008 R2; Windows Server 2008 Service Pack 2; Windows Vista Service Pack 2
Vea también
Referencia
Clase de DataCache
Miembros de DataCache
Espacio de nombres de Microsoft.ApplicationServer.Caching